Ankündigung

Einklappen
Keine Ankündigung bisher.

Unterschidliche css na Bildschirmauflösung

Einklappen

Neue Werbung 2019

Einklappen
X
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• Unterschidliche css na Bildschirmauflösung

    hi leute,
    ich habe von javascript leider so gut wie keine ahnung aber sehe keine andere möglichkeit weiter zu kommen ohne.
    Ich hätte gerne je nach Bildschirmauflösung des Users eine unterschiedliche css geladen.
    habe auch einen code gefunden aber leider läuft der nicht mit dem IE sondern nur mit Mozilla.
    kann mir jemand sagen was dort falsch dran ist ???

    Code:
    <head>
    <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
    <title>Unbenanntes Dokument</title>
    <link rel="stylesheet" type="text/css" disabled="true" href="css/medium.css" title="Aufl&ouml;sung: 1024x768"> 
    <link rel="stylesheet" type="text/css" disabled="true" href="css/large.css" title="Aufl&ouml;sung: 1280x1024"> 
    <link rel="stylesheet" type="text/css"  href="css/small.css" title="Aufl&ouml;sung: 800x600"> 
    <script type="text/javascript">
    <!--
    function changeCss()
    {
    var xscreen = screen.width;
    
    
    if(xscreen == 1024 )
    {
      document.styleSheets[0].disabled = false;
      document.styleSheets[1].disabled = true;
      document.styleSheets[2].disabled = true;
    }
    
    else if(xscreen == 1280 )
     {
      document.styleSheets[0].disabled = true;
      document.styleSheets[1].disabled = false;
      document.styleSheets[2].disabled = true;
     }
    
    else
     {
      document.styleSheets[0].disabled = true;
      document.styleSheets[1].disabled = true;
      document.styleSheets[2].disabled = false;
     }
    }
    
    --></script>
    </head>


  • #2
    Code:
    var width = window.innerWidth ||                      // alle Browser
      (window.document.documentElement.clientWidth ||     // IE im Standard-Mode
       window.document.body.clientWidth);                 // IE im Quirks-Mode
    var height = window.innerHeight || 
       (window.document.documentElement.clientHeight || 
        window.document.body.clientHeight);
    I like cooking my family and my pets.
    Use commas. Don't be a psycho.
    Blog - CoverflowJS

    Kommentar


    • #3
      deine Antwort ist ja lieb und nett aber bringt mich das nicht wirklich weiter. zumindestens kann ich nicht verstehen was du wirklich damit gemeint hast

      Kommentar


      • #4
        ich habe von javascript leider so gut wie keine ahnung
        zumindestens kann ich nicht verstehen was du wirklich damit gemeint hast
        kann mir jemand sagen was dort falsch dran ist ?
        Dann lautet die ANtwort vermutlich: Nein.
        --

        „Emoticons machen einen Beitrag etwas freundlicher. Deine wirken zwar fachlich richtig sein, aber meist ziemlich uninteressant.
        Wenn man nur Text sieht, haben viele junge Entwickler keine interesse, diese stumpfen Texte zu lesen.“


        --

        Kommentar


        • #5
          vielen dank für eure tatkräftige Hilfe. ich habe eine andere Lösung gefunden.
          möchte nur abschließen mit den worten

          Die Arroganz des Weisen, ist die Leiter des Lehrlings!

          Kommentar


          • #6
            Ich habe auch einen:

            Wer eine Antwort sucht, sollte erst lernen, Fragen zu stellen.

            Oder:

            Schuster bleibt bei Deinen Leisten.
            --

            „Emoticons machen einen Beitrag etwas freundlicher. Deine wirken zwar fachlich richtig sein, aber meist ziemlich uninteressant.
            Wenn man nur Text sieht, haben viele junge Entwickler keine interesse, diese stumpfen Texte zu lesen.“


            --

            Kommentar

            Lädt...
            X